X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=lib%2Fpackets.h;h=20065ade9cfd545ed0d8a4c8899ca12f4c98633d;hb=7fae24e67c95b1dbe93497135ae533e39b61e110;hp=f45c33121fa11fead88950d88ac1418766c928e9;hpb=81aee5f901556e778069a70613d99a87ddcf2116;p=openvswitch diff --git a/lib/packets.h b/lib/packets.h index f45c3312..20065ade 100644 --- a/lib/packets.h +++ b/lib/packets.h @@ -328,8 +328,8 @@ BUILD_ASSERT_DECL(UDP_HEADER_LEN == sizeof(struct udp_header)); #define TCP_ACK 0x10 #define TCP_URG 0x20 -#define TCP_FLAGS(tcp_ctl) (htons(tcp_ctl) & 0x003f) -#define TCP_OFFSET(tcp_ctl) (htons(tcp_ctl) >> 12) +#define TCP_FLAGS(tcp_ctl) (ntohs(tcp_ctl) & 0x003f) +#define TCP_OFFSET(tcp_ctl) (ntohs(tcp_ctl) >> 12) #define TCP_HEADER_LEN 20 struct tcp_header {